Carroll Construction Supply is looking to hire an experienced Credit Manager Assistant. This role involves assisting the Credit Department in managing customer onboarding, credit monitoring, and collections to reduce bad debt.

Responsibilities
Manage customer onboarding, credit monitoring and collections
Regular review of receivable aging reports to identify accounts that require follow up
Research, document and resolve outstanding issues and balances. Resolve escalated collection issues. Interface with customer and sales team to assist in collection as required
Ensure accounts receivable balances are maintained at appropriate levels for the economic environment and business situation
Consult and work closely with management and appropriate staff on complex collections and/or situations requiring extraordinary efforts to resolve
Provide reporting on highest risk accounts including recommendation for resolution
Build strong customer relationships to create maximum value, routinely communicate via email and telephone with customers and internal associates
Oversee the filing of liens, lien releases and consult with legal counsel when appropriate
Establish and maintain external business/industry relationships including attorneys, collection agencies and other credit associations
Continuously seek out new ways to automate, streamline, or eliminate tasks in the credit department to improve processes and reduce costs
